Byomkesh Bakshi is the first Hindi Television series based on the Byomkesh Bakshi character created by Sharadindu Bandyopadhyay. The series stars Rajit Kapur and K.K. Raina as Byomkesh Bakshi and Ajit Kumar Banerji respectively. It became critically acclaimed and most celebrated adaptation of the character keeping it fresh even after decades.[1][2]

Synopsis[edit]
Byomkesh Bakshi is a Bengali Detective who takes on spine-chilling cases with his sidekick Ajitkumar Banerji. Byomkesh identifies himself as Satyanweshi meaning 'truth seeker' rather than a detective. He stands out from other legendary detectives like Poirot or Holmes because he is more concerned with truth than with law as evidenced from his cases where he lets the perpetrator die by manipulating the circumstances using their own methods as a redemption and deliverance of justice for the victim in absence of evidence as in Balak Jasoos, Ret Ka Daldal and a few other cases.
Basu Chatterjee adapted each novel by Sharadindu Bandyopadhyay into an episode (except Chiriyaghar and Aadim Shatru, which are made in two part episodes).

There were 2 seasons having 34 episodes. First season of 14 and second season of 20 episodes.[6]
Season 1 (1993)[edit]
- Satyanweshi : Byomkesh Bakshi investigates murders that have taken place in a particular locality. He assumes an alias and starts living in the hostel run by the homeopathic doctor Anukul babu. Initially told that there weren't rooms available, he convinces Ajit Kumar Banerjee to share a room with him. Then, by applying deductive methods, he soon identifies the murderer and induces an attack from him, this catching him red handed.
- Raste Ka Kanta : An advertisement in the newspaper draws the attention of Bakshi. Although seemingly funny, this advertisement 'agar aap raaste ke kaante se..' seems to have a more dangerous implication. A client approaches Bakshi and narrates how he was almost pierced by an object while walking on the street. Byomkesh investigates the matter and catches this dangerous person who has a special method of killing people.

Byomkesh is a 2014 IndianBengalicrime fiction television series based on the Bengali sleuthByomkesh Bakshi created by Sharadindu Bandyopadhyay. The series stars Gaurav Chakrabarty, Saugata Bandyopadhyay and Ridhima Ghosh as Byomkesh Bakshi, Ajit and Satyabati respectively.[1] The series premiered on 20 November 2014 on Colors Bangla channel and ended on 14 November 2015. The first episode was narrated by Sabyasachi Chakrabarty.
Summary[edit]
Byomkesh Bakshi (Gaurav Chakrabarty) is a young Bengali private detective who solves spine-chilling cases with his chronicler and associate Ajit Bandyopadhyay (Saugata Bandyopadhyay).

Controversies[edit]
It has been reported[4] that the shooting has been halted by a notification issued by the Artist Forum when they received several complaints against the production house Dag Creative Media. Complaints had been made by several artistes about non payment of dues for multiple months. The Federation of Cine Technicians and Workers of Eastern India has come out in support of the artists.
